MOVERS&SHAKERS ‘Rapid expansion gathers pace’ » » PURPLEX, THE LEADING FULL- service marketing agency, has made three key appointments as its rapid expansion gathers pace. Paula Gledhill joins as PR and Marketing Manager for the Ascot Group, which includes Purplex and sister company Insight Data, and will head up PR, awards and media distribution for the group. Paula has previously worked for the BBC as a broadcast journalist, television researcher and producer/director, before moving into marketing and PR in the food and e-commerce sector. New Digital Account Executive Christy Riddell joins Purplex after working in account management for 21 years managing client relationships at board level and below for FTSE100 and NHS Foundation Trust clients. And the SEO team has been strengthened by the appointment of Nikita Mohide. Having completed a placement year at Pfizer in the digital marketing department, Nikita graduated from Aston University in psychology and business and has joined Purplex as an SEO Executive. He will oversee the continued growth as Reynaers expands its trade and retail offerings and builds on its success in the commercial sector. A Birmingham local, Richard has over 22 years’ experience in sales, marketing, engineering and supply chain roles. He joins from Schaeffler, where he has held board positions for over 12 years, leading on projects across the automotive and industrial sides of the business in the UK and Ireland. Andreas Wilsdorf, Chief Sales Officer at Reynaers Group said: “The collective knowledge, expertise and experience that Richard brings to the firm is exactly what we need to head up our UK team.
